Crafting the Perfect Cucumber Roll Ups: A Step-by-Step Guide
The beauty of
cucumber roll ups with sun dried tomato sauce lies in their simplicity, but a few key techniques can elevate your creation from good to absolutely sublime.
Selecting and Preparing Your Cucumber
*
Choose Wisely: Opt for large, firm English or Persian cucumbers. These varieties tend to have fewer seeds, thinner skins, and a more consistent shape, making them ideal for slicing. Avoid standard garden cucumbers, which can be too watery and seedy.
*
The Art of Slicing: The secret to successful rolls is thin, uniform slices. A mandoline slicer is your best friend here, creating perfectly consistent ribbons effortlessly. If you don't have one, a sharp vegetable peeler or a very sharp chef's knife can also work with a steady hand. Aim for slices about 1/16th to 1/8th of an inch thick.
*
Double Up for Durability: Because the slices are so thin, they can be delicate. For each roll, layer two slices slightly overlapping lengthwise. This provides extra stability and a more satisfying crunch when rolled.
The Creamy Core: Hummus or Feta?
The filling acts as both a binder and a flavor enhancer, creating a delightful contrast with the crisp cucumber.
*
Classic Hummus: A thin layer of your favorite hummus spread lengthwise down each doubled-up cucumber slice is the traditional choice for these rolls. It provides a creamy texture, a nutty flavor, and keeps the appetizer fully vegan. You can use store-bought or homemade hummus, perhaps even experimenting with roasted red pepper or garlic hummus for an extra kick.
*
Tangy Feta Alternative: For those who love a bit of dairy and a Mediterranean flair, a creamy feta spread is an excellent option. Crumble feta cheese and mix it with a touch of cream cheese or Greek yogurt until spreadable. *
Other Ideas: Don't limit yourself! Consider mashed avocado seasoned with lime and chili, herbed cream cheese, or even a pesto spread for different flavor profiles.
Rolling with Confidence
Once your cucumber slices are prepared and spread with your chosen filling, it’s time to roll. Start from one end and carefully roll the cucumber tightly, but not so tight that the filling squeezes out. The double-layered slices should hold their shape well. Arrange them seam-side down on a platter.
The Star of the Show: Homemade Sun Dried Tomato Sauce
While the cucumber rolls provide the refreshing crunch, it's the rich, intensely flavorful sun-dried tomato sauce that truly makes this appetizer sing. This sauce is a game-changer, not just for these rolls but for countless other dishes.
Ingredients Breakdown and Flavor Harmony
*
Sun-Dried Tomatoes (3 oz): These are the backbone of your sauce. For best flavor and texture, use oil-packed sun-dried tomatoes, drained. If you have dry-packed, rehydrate them first in warm water for about 15-20 minutes, then drain thoroughly. The concentrated sweetness and umami are irreplaceable.
*
Roasted Red Peppers (2 medium): Jarred roasted red peppers work perfectly here. They add a wonderful sweetness, a smoky depth, and contribute to the sauce's vibrant color and smooth texture.
*
Water (1/2 cup): This helps achieve the desired creamy consistency and allows the blender to work efficiently. You can always adjust this amount to make the sauce thicker or thinner.
*
Raw Garlic (2 cloves): Fresh garlic provides a pungent, aromatic kick that brightens the sauce and complements the tomatoes.
*
Fresh Basil (1/4 cup): The herbaceous notes of fresh basil are a classic pairing with tomatoes, adding a touch of peppery freshness and an authentic Mediterranean aroma.
*
Salt (1/2 teaspoon, or to taste): Essential for enhancing all the other flavors. Always taste and adjust as needed, especially if your sun-dried tomatoes or hummus are already salty.
Blending Your Way to Perfection
The process couldn't be simpler. Combine all the sauce ingredients – sun-dried tomatoes, roasted red peppers, water, raw garlic, fresh basil, and salt – into a high-speed blender. Blend on high until the mixture is completely smooth and creamy. Scrape down the sides as needed to ensure everything is incorporated.
This recipe yields a very thick, intensely flavored sauce, which is ideal for dolloping on top of your cucumber rolls. If you prefer a looser consistency for, say, a pasta sauce or a salad dressing, feel free to add a tablespoon of water at a time until it reaches your desired thickness. Always taste and adjust seasonings after thinning.

Tips for Success & Serving Suggestions
To ensure your
cucumber roll ups with sun dried tomato sauce are always a showstopper, keep these practical tips in mind:
*
Make Ahead Smartly: You can prepare the sun-dried tomato sauce up to 3-4 days in advance and store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. Slice the cucumbers and have your filling ready. Assemble the rolls closer to serving time (within 1-2 hours) to prevent the cucumbers from becoming watery and the rolls from getting soggy.
*
Garnish for Impact: A simple garnish can make all the difference. Top each roll with a small dollop of the sun-dried tomato sauce, then sprinkle with a tiny fresh basil leaf, a pinch of red pepper flakes for a subtle heat, or a light drizzle of high-quality extra virgin olive oil.
*
Temperature Matters: Serve the rolls chilled. The crispness of the cold cucumber is key to their refreshing appeal.
